A plugin that adds soft-delete functionality to Objection.js

awaitUser.query().where('id',1).delete();// db now has: { User id: 1, deleted: true, ... }constuser=awaitUser.query().where('id',1).first();awaituser.$query().delete();// sameconstdeletedUser=awaitUser.query().where('id',1).first();// => { User id: 1, deleted: true, ... }constactiveUsers=awaitUser.query().whereNotDeleted();constdeletedUsers=awaitUser.query().whereDeleted();awaitUser.query().where('id',1).undelete();// db now has: { User id: 1, deleted: false, ... }awaitUser.query.where('id',1).hardDelete();// => row with id:1 is permanently deletedA notDeleted and a deleted filter will be added to the list of named filters for any model that mixes in the plugin. These filters use the .whereNotDeleted() and .whereDeleted() functions to filter records, and can be used without needing to remember the specific columnName for any model:

// a model with soft deleteclassPhoneextendssoftDelete(Model){staticgettableName(){return'Phones';}}// a model without soft deleteclassEmailextendsModel{staticgettableName(){return'Emails';}}// assume a User model that relates to both, and the following existing data:User{id: 1,name: 'Johnny Cash',phones: [{id: 6,number: '+19195551234',},],emails: [{id: 3,address: 'mib@americanrecords.com',},]}// then:awaitUser.query().upsertGraph({id: 1,name: 'Johnny Cash',phones: [],emails: [],});// => phone id 6 will be flagged deleted (and will still be related to Johnny!), email id 3 will be removed from the databasecolumnName: the name of the column to use as the soft delete flag on the model (Default: 'deleted'). The column must exist on the table for the model.
You can specify different column names per-model by using the options:
